summaryrefslogtreecommitdiffstats
path: root/scripts
diff options
context:
space:
mode:
authorJo-Philipp Wich <jo@mein.io>2016-04-13 15:33:53 +0200
committerJo-Philipp Wich <jo@mein.io>2016-04-13 15:33:53 +0200
commit9a04a806772919c2ab2b599e134eae0d60e6e0a6 (patch)
treef07a116a426a7fca315e40dfc319a4a6160dfdc5 /scripts
parentaad2b92603d5d317a4acac446ca2ed1e97ae7b02 (diff)
downloadmaster-31e0f0ae-9a04a806772919c2ab2b599e134eae0d60e6e0a6.tar.gz
master-31e0f0ae-9a04a806772919c2ab2b599e134eae0d60e6e0a6.tar.bz2
master-31e0f0ae-9a04a806772919c2ab2b599e134eae0d60e6e0a6.zip
scripts: metadata: use the new "Repository" field
Switch to the new "Repository" metadata field to populate tmp/.packagesubdirs Signed-off-by: Jo-Philipp Wich <jo@mein.io>
Diffstat (limited to 'scripts')
-rwxr-xr-xscripts/metadata.pl4
-rw-r--r--scripts/metadata.pm1
2 files changed, 3 insertions, 2 deletions
diff --git a/scripts/metadata.pl b/scripts/metadata.pl
index 6ad3c39f00..a55b7990f7 100755
--- a/scripts/metadata.pl
+++ b/scripts/metadata.pl
@@ -849,8 +849,8 @@ sub gen_package_subdirs() {
parse_package_metadata($ARGV[0]) or exit 1;
foreach my $name (sort {uc($a) cmp uc($b)} keys %package) {
my $pkg = $package{$name};
- if ($pkg->{name} && $pkg->{package_subdir}) {
- print "Package/$name/subdir = $pkg->{package_subdir}\n";
+ if ($pkg->{name} && $pkg->{repository}) {
+ print "Package/$name/subdir = $pkg->{repository}\n";
}
}
}
diff --git a/scripts/metadata.pm b/scripts/metadata.pm
index 8e285e53a8..e00f4e97cf 100644
--- a/scripts/metadata.pm
+++ b/scripts/metadata.pm
@@ -223,6 +223,7 @@ sub parse_package_metadata($) {
/^Build-Depends\/(\w+): \s*(.+)\s*$/ and $pkg->{"builddepends/$1"} = [ split /\s+/, $2 ];
/^Build-Types:\s*(.+)\s*$/ and $pkg->{buildtypes} = [ split /\s+/, $1 ];
/^Package-Subdir:\s*(.+?)\s*$/ and $pkg->{package_subdir} = $1;
+ /^Repository:\s*(.+?)\s*$/ and $pkg->{repository} = $1;
/^Category: \s*(.+)\s*$/ and do {
$pkg->{category} = $1;
defined $category{$1} or $category{$1} = {};